OAKLAND, Calif. — Point guard Tyreke Evans will play for the New Orleans Pelicans in Game 2 of their first-round playoff series against the Golden State Warriors, while backup Jrue Holiday is out with an injury.

The Pelicans say Evans will play in Monday night’s game despite a bone bruise in his left knee and Holiday is sitting out with soreness in his lower right leg. The Warriors lead the best-of-seven series 1-0.

Evans was injured in a collision with Warriors forward Andre Iguodala in Game 1. Holiday missed 41 games with a stress reaction in his right leg before returning April 10.

Norris Cole is expected to play behind Evans.
